website/content/en/status/report-2022-10-2022-12/cheribsd.adoc
28

The FreeBSD Documentation Primer has a recommendation for American spelling here: https://docs.freebsd.org/en/books/fdp-primer/writing-style/#writing-style-guidelines . It might be argued that status reports fall into the exception of contributed articles, but even in that case consistency is still required. So I am going to use the American spelling here.
